usb: ehci-omap: update clock names to be more generic



Rename usbhost2_120m_fck to usbhost_hs_fck and usbhost1_48m_fck
to usbhost_fs_fck, to better reflect the clocks' functionalities.

In OMAP4, the frequencies for the corresponding clocks are not
necessarily the same as with OMAP3, however the functionalities
are.
